The 10 Main Causes of Yellow Leaves: An In-Depth Analysis

Now that we have an initial diagnosis, it's time to explore the causes in detail. Each problem has its specific "fingerprint." Learning to recognize it is key to targeted and effective intervention.

1. Incorrect Watering: The Silent Killer No. 1

The most common mistake in indoor gardening is related to water. Both excess and deficiency can lead to yellow leaves, but with different manifestations.
Overwatering: This is the most frequent cause. When the soil is constantly waterlogged, the roots cannot breathe. Oxygen is essential for their nutrient absorption function. Without oxygen, the roots begin to suffocate and rot (root rot). The plant, no longer receiving nourishment, sacrifices its leaves, which become yellow and soft, often starting from the lower ones. A typical sign is widespread yellowing and a general "droopy" and distressed appearance of the plant.
Underwatering: Conversely, if the plant does not receive enough water, it lacks the necessary hydraulic pressure to keep tissues turgid and transport nutrients. The leaves, especially the lower and older ones, begin to yellow, becoming dry and crispy to the touch, before falling off.

2. Iron Chlorosis: Iron Deficiency

Iron chlorosis is one of the most recognizable nutritional deficiencies. Iron is an essential microelement for chlorophyll synthesis. When it is lacking, the plant cannot produce the green pigment. The unmistakable symptom is interveinal yellowing: younger, upper leaves turn yellow, almost white in severe cases, while the veins remain dark green, creating a sharp, reticulated contrast. This problem is often related not to an actual absence of iron in the soil, but to a soil pH that is too alkaline (above 7), which blocks iron absorption by the roots.

3. Nitrogen (N) Deficiency

Nitrogen is a macronutrient, one of the fundamental building blocks for plant growth, responsible for leaf and stem development. A nitrogen deficiency typically manifests as uniform yellowing starting from the older, lower leaves of the plant. This happens because nitrogen is a mobile element: the plant, in case of deficiency, moves it from older leaves to new ones to support growth. Affected leaves turn completely yellow and then fall off.

4. Inadequate Light: Too Much or Too Little

Every plant has its specific light requirements.
Too Much Light (Direct Sun): Exposing a shade-loving plant (like a Calathea) to direct sunlight can cause actual sunburn. The leaves appear faded, yellow, or with white and dry spots in the most exposed areas.
Too Little Light: Insufficient light prevents the plant from performing photosynthesis efficiently. The plant, in an attempt to conserve energy, may begin to sacrifice leaves, which yellow and fall, often those furthest from the light source.

5. Drainage Problems and Root Rot

This point is closely related to overwatering but deserves a separate mention. A pot without drainage holes or soil that is too compact and clayey is a death sentence for most houseplants. Water stagnates at the bottom, creating an anaerobic environment perfect for the development of pathogenic fungi that cause root rot. Surface symptoms include yellow leaves, stunted growth, and an unpleasant odor coming from the soil.

6. Pests and Diseases

A pest attack can weaken the plant and cause leaves to yellow.
Sucking Insects (Aphids, Mealybugs, Spider Mites): These small pests feed on plant sap, draining vital nutrients. Their presence causes yellow spots, leaf deformities, and general decline. Mealybugs, in particular, appear as small white or brown shields, often along the veins.
Fungal Diseases: Fungi like powdery mildew or scab can cause yellow or brown spots on leaves, often surrounded by a halo.

7. Natural Aging (Senescence)

It's important not to unnecessarily alarm yourself. It is perfectly normal for older leaves of a plant, usually those at the base, to eventually yellow and fall. This is the plant's natural life cycle, which eliminates less efficient leaves to concentrate energy on new, more productive ones.

8. Transplant or Environmental Shock

Plants are creatures of habit. A sudden change, such as repotting, moving to a new room, or exposure to cold drafts, can cause shock. The plant may react by losing some leaves, which first turn yellow. This is usually a temporary reaction, and the plant will recover once acclimatized.

9. Temperature and Environmental Stress

Temperature fluctuations, drafts (both hot and cold), or proximity to heat sources like radiators can stress the plant and lead to yellowing leaves. Most indoor plants prefer stable temperatures, between 18°C and 24°C.

10. Incorrect Soil pH

As mentioned for iron chlorosis, an unsuitable soil pH can block the absorption of many essential nutrients, even if present in the soil. Acid-loving plants like azaleas or hydrangeas will suffer in alkaline soil, showing widespread yellowing. This is an often underestimated factor but is of crucial importance for the long-term health of the plant.

Immediate Solutions: First Aid for Your Plants

Have you diagnosed the problem? Excellent. Now it's time to act. Here are the "first aid" actions to take depending on the identified cause.
If you suspect overwatering: Stop watering immediately. Gently remove the plant from the pot and check the roots. If they are dark, soft, and foul-smelling, rot is present. Remove damaged roots with clean scissors and repot in fresh, well-draining soil. If the rot is limited, simply let the soil dry out before watering again.
If you suspect underwatering: Water immediately, but don't overdo it. The best technique is immersion: submerge the pot in a basin of water for 15-20 minutes, until the soil is completely moist, then let the excess drain well.
If you suspect nutrient deficiency (Iron or Nitrogen): Administer a specific fertilizer. For iron chlorosis, use a product based on chelated iron, which is easily absorbable. For nitrogen deficiency, a good liquid fertilizer for green plants (with a high N content) will be perfect. Results will not be immediate, but you should see improvement on new leaves within a couple of weeks.
If you suspect a light problem: Move the plant immediately. If it is sunburned, move it away from the window or shade it with a light curtain. If the light is insufficient, move it closer to a brighter window, but without exposing it to direct sun (unless the species requires it).
If you suspect a pest attack: Isolate the plant to prevent the infestation from spreading. Manually remove visible pests with a cotton swab soaked in alcohol. Subsequently, treat the plant with a specific product, such as Neem oil or potassium soft soap, which are effective and environmentally friendly.

Step-by-Step Guide: How to Save a Plant with Yellow Leaves

Follow this methodical process to tackle the problem strategically and leave nothing to chance.
Step 1: Observation and Isolation
Isolate the plant: As soon as you notice the problem, move the plant away from others to prevent any spread of pests or diseases.
Observe carefully: Take a few minutes for an in-depth analysis. Check above and below the leaves, the stem, the soil surface. Look for insects, spots, cobwebs, or mold. Use the diagnostic table to get an idea.
Step 2: Root Check (Moment of Truth)
Remove the plant from the pot: Gently slide the root ball out of the pot. This is the most important check-up.
Analyze the roots: How do they look? Healthy roots are typically white, firm, and spread throughout the root ball. Brown, black, soft, or foul-smelling roots are a clear sign of root rot.
Assess compaction: Do the roots form a dense, compact mass that has taken the shape of the pot? The plant is "root-bound" and urgently needs repotting.
Step 3: Pruning and Cleaning
Remove compromised leaves: Cut off all completely yellow or dry leaves at the base of the petiole with clean, disinfected scissors. They will not turn green again and only drain energy from the plant.
Prune damaged roots: If you found rot, it is essential to remove all soft and dark parts of the roots. Be decisive: a diseased root will not heal and can infect others.
Step 4: Repotting and Choosing the Substrate
Choose the right pot: If the plant was root-bound, choose a pot with a slightly larger diameter (2-4 cm more). ALWAYS ensure it has adequate drainage holes at the bottom.
Prepare the perfect potting mix: Don't use just any soil. Create a draining mix by adding components like perlite, pumice, or volcanic rock to universal potting soil. This will ensure excellent aeration for the roots.
Repot correctly: Place a layer of expanded clay at the bottom of the pot, add some potting soil, place the plant in the center, and fill the empty spaces, pressing lightly.
Step 5: Watering and Post-Care Fertilization
Water cautiously: After repotting, water lightly to settle the soil, but do not soak it. Wait until the soil is almost completely dry before watering again.
Wait to fertilize: Do not fertilize a stressed or newly repotted plant. Wait at least 4-6 weeks before resuming a light fertilization schedule.
Step 6: Monitoring and Patience
Check the plant regularly: Observe it every couple of days. Check the soil moisture, the appearance of new leaves, and any recurrence of problems.
Be patient: Recovery is not immediate. The plant needs time to adapt and grow new roots and leaves. Don't be discouraged if you don't see immediate improvements.

Specific Cases: Yellow Leaves in the Most Popular Plants

Each plant has its "character" and its weaknesses. Let's see how leaf yellowing manifests in some of the most beloved houseplants and how to intervene effectively.

Yellow Leaves on Monstera Deliciosa

Monstera is a robust plant, but the most common mistake is overwatering. If you notice yellow leaves, especially the lower ones and without new fenestrations, you are almost certainly watering too much. Check the soil: it should dry out for at least the first 5-7 cm before watering again. A lack of light can also cause the yellowing of older leaves, as the plant tries to optimize resources towards the leaves that receive more light.

Yellow Leaves on Pothos (Scindapsus)

Pothos is famous for its resilience, but it is not immune to yellowing. If you see many yellow leaves that fall off easily, the cause is almost always overwatering. Pothos prefers to be slightly dry rather than constantly moist. If, on the other hand, the leaves appear faded and yellow, but the plant seems "thirsty," you may have waited too long between waterings. It is a plant that communicates very clearly: learn to observe it.

Yellow Leaves on Ficus (e.g., Lyrata or Benjamina)

Ficus are notoriously sensitive to environmental shock. A change of position, a draft, or repotting can cause a dramatic shedding of yellow leaves. If you have ruled out watering problems, think about any recent changes. For Ficus Lyrata, dry brown spots starting from the edge and surrounded by a yellow halo may indicate irregular watering (too much or too little).

Yellow Leaves on Sansevieria

Sansevieria is a succulent plant, and its number one enemy is root rot. If its fleshy leaves turn yellow and soft at the base, you have definitely overwatered. This plant stores water in its leaves and requires very little watering, especially in winter. Before you see a yellow leaf, the base of the plant will probably already be rotted. In this case, the only solution is to try to propagate the healthy parts of the leaf.

FAQ - Frequently Asked Questions about Yellow Leaves

Q: Is it normal for a plant to lose some yellow leaves? A: Yes, it is absolutely normal. Older leaves, at the base of the plant, complete their life cycle, turn yellow, and fall to make way for new growth. Only worry if the yellowing is widespread, rapid, or affects young leaves.
Q: Should I cut off yellow leaves? A: Yes. A completely yellow leaf will not turn green again and only consumes energy. Cut it off at the base with clean scissors. If a leaf is only partially yellow, you can wait for the plant to reabsorb mobile nutrients before removing it.
Q: Can tap water cause yellow leaves? A: In some cases, yes. Very hard water (rich in limescale) can alter the soil pH over time, making it difficult to absorb nutrients like iron. In addition, chlorine can be harmful to sensitive plants. Letting the water sit for 24 hours before use can help evaporate the chlorine.
Q: Will fertilizing more solve the yellow leaf problem? A: Not necessarily, and it could worsen the situation. Fertilizing a plant stressed by overwatering or a pest attack can "burn" the roots. Fertilize only when you have identified a clear nutritional deficiency and the plant is in a condition to recover.
Q: How long does it take to see improvements? A: It depends on the cause and severity of the problem. After correcting a nutritional deficiency, you might see improvements on new leaves within 2-3 weeks. If the problem was watering, the plant might show signs of recovery (turgid leaves) in a few days. Be patient.
